WHAT: The Institute of Food Technologists (IFT) 2014 Annual Meeting & Food Expo®, will bring together professionals involved in both the science and the business of food — experts from industry, academia and government. With more than 900 companies exhibiting, this event showcases the largest, most diverse collection of food ingredient, equipment, and packaging suppliers from all over the world. Over 100 educational sessions and 1,000 poster presentations will provide information on the latest developments and trends in food science.

WHO: The Opening General Session keynote presentation will feature Doug Rauch, former president of Trader Joe's, on Sunday, June 22, from 8:30-10:15 a.m. Rauch, renowned for growing Trader Joe’s from a small, nine-store chain in Southern California to a nationally acclaimed retail success story with more than 340 stores in 30 states, will share his thoughts about how to feed the world, one healthy, sustainably-sourced meal at a time.Educational Session Highlights:• Azodicarbonamide: A Case Study of Perceptions of the Safety of Food Ingredients• Perspectives on the GMO Debate• A Deeper Look Into the Post-Trans Fat World• Millenials: What's On Their Plate?• Potential of Insects as Food• The Safety of Spices: Challenges and Opportunities

About IFT This year marks the 75th anniversary of the Institute of Food Technologists. Since its founding in 1939, IFT has been committed to advancing the science of food, both today and tomorrow. Our non-profit scientific society—more than 18,000 members from more than 100 countries—brings together food scientists, technologists and related professionals from academia, government and industry.
